Different approaches to digestive rest
Fasting protocols vary across retreats, allowing you to choose the depth of cleanse that fits your current vitality. Several retreats focus on liquid nutrition, providing fresh juice cleanses designed to rest the digestive tract while sustaining daily movement. Others pair whole, organic farm-to-table vegetarian meals with optional fasting tracks, giving you the freedom to decide how light to go each day.
Rather than strict deprivation, these programs treat digestive rest as one pillar among many. You will often find fasting integrated with daily hatha or vinyasa yoga, somatic movement, and quiet reflection, ensuring the body remains grounded and nurtured throughout the process.
Supporting the body beyond nutrition
Cleansing extends beyond what you consume or step away from at meal times. The retreats gathered here surround fasting protocols with complementary practices that support physical ease and mental calm. Daily spa treatments, traditional bodywork, and sauna sessions help release tension, while breathwork, sound baths, and nervous system regulation encourage deep relaxation.
Some journeys also incorporate digital detoxes, ocean swims, or quiet walks through surrounding forests and rice fields. Stepping away from screens, stimulants, and everyday demands allows the nervous system to settle, making digestive stillness feel like a natural extension of an unhurried, quiet environment.
How to choose your retreat duration and setting
Consider how much time and stillness you need when selecting an experience. Shorter 4-day retreats offer a focused reset, ideal if you want a gentle introduction to juice fasting paired with daily spa sessions and light yoga. Longer 7-day and 8-day immersions provide the space for deeper emotional and physical unwinding, often including cultural ceremonies, one-to-one coaching, or somatic integration circles.
Setting also shapes your experience. A private villa or quiet village beside a river invites introspection, while coastal retreats add ocean air and water meditation. Choose an environment and schedule that give you full permission to rest.
